What to do if Sennheiser Wireless Headphones have no audio?
If you're not getting any sound from your Sennheiser Wireless Headphones, it could be due to several reasons. First, ensure your headphones are properly paired with your device. If they are not paired, you should pair them. Also, check that your headphones and smartphone are switched on. Make sure that Bluetooth is activated on your smartphone. If the issue persists, try clearing the pairing settings from the headphones and pairing them again.
